More than 800mm of rain has inundated parts of southeast Queensland during the last four days, with more severe weather on the way.
A persistent and deep stream of moisture-laden winds feeding into an upper-level pool of cold air has produced days of heavy rain in parts of southeast Queensland and northeast NSW.
